在美国当代英语语料库统计的20000万个常用词中,take位居第62位,在4.5亿个单词中出现了670745次。今天就带大家一起来系统学习take的用法。

频率最高的搭配:

Take place(发生)>take care(注意、小心)>take a look(看一看)>take step(采取措施)>take advantage(利用)

词形变化:

takes、took、taken

Take词义解析:

1. to remove something, especially without permission拿;夺取;取走

Has anything been taken (= stolen)?

丢了什么东西吗?

Here's your book - I took it by mistake.

你的书在这里,我拿错了。

2. to subtract a number (= remove it from another number) 减

If you take 8 (away) from 19 you get 11.

19减8得11。

3. to move something or someone from one place to another拿走,带走

Take your umbrella (with you) when you go out.

外出时记得带伞。

Take the book up/down to the third floor of the library.

把书拿到图书馆的3层。

4. to accept or have接受,接纳;收受

Do they take credit cards here?

他们这儿可以刷信用卡吗?

Do you take milk in your coffee?

你茶里要放牛奶吗?

This container will take (= has room for) six litres.

这种容器容量为6升。

5. to move in order to hold something in the hand(s)手执,握住,抓住

Can you take this bag while I open the door?

你帮我拿一下包我去开门好吗?

He took my arm and led me outside.

他拉住我的手臂,领我到了门外。

Take an egg and break it into the bowl.

拿一个鸡蛋打在碗里。

6. to go somewhere with someone, often paying for that person or being responsible for them带(某人)去(某地)

We're taking the kids to the zoo on Saturday.

星期六我们要带孩子们去动物园。

7. to travel somewhere by using a particular form of transport or a particular vehicle, route, etc.搭乘(交通工具)

I always take the train - it's less hassle than a car.

我总是乘火车——乘火车比开车省事。

She took the 10.30 flight to Shanghai.

她乘10点半的飞机去了上海。

8. to need要求,需要

Parachuting takes a lot of nerve.

跳伞需要很大的勇气。

[ + -ing verb ] His story took some believing (= was difficult to believe).

他的故事令人难以置信。

9. If something takes a particular time, that period is needed in order to complete it.花费(时间)

The cooking process only takes 5 minutes.

烹饪过程只需5分钟。

10. to swallow or use a medicine or drug, especially in a regular way口服,送服(服用一种药品或毒品,特别是以有规则的方式服用)

Take this medicine two times a day.

这种药每天服2次。

11. to do or perform从事,进行

She is taking (= studying) biology at university.

她在大学里读生物学。

The Archbishop took our service of thanksgiving.

大主教为我们主持了感恩祈祷仪式。

词组搭配:

1. take after sb

to be similar to an older member of your family in appearance or character

(在外貌、性格等方面)与(家庭中某个年纪较大成员)相像

He takes after his mother/his mother's side of the family.

他很像他母亲/他母亲家的人。

2. take sb aback

to surprise or shock someone so much that they do not know how to behave for a short time使(某人)大吃一惊

The news really took us aback.

这消息着实令我们吃了一惊。

3. take sth away

to remove something拿走,移走

Take these chairs away.

把这些椅子拿走。

4. take sth down

to remove something that is on a wall or something that is temporary, or to remove a structure by separating its different parts 拿下;拆掉;拆除

I took the pictures down.

我已经取下了那些画。

俚语:

1. take your time

said to mean that you can spend as much time as you need in doing something, or that you should slow down

不着急,慢慢来

to do something too slowly

做事磨蹭

The builders are really taking their time.

那些建筑工人真会磨蹭。

2. take a walk!

a rude way of telling someone to go away

走开,滚开(让某人走开的一种不礼貌方式)

The guy kept pestering her, and finally she told him to take a walk.

那家伙不断地骚扰她,最后她叫他滚开。

3. take one (thing) at a time

to do or deal with one thing before starting to do or deal with another

(对问题)一个个来处理

There are a few problems, but let's take one thing at a time.

现在有一些问题,不过我们得一个个来处理。
